Auglaize County Sheriff’s Office Urges Residents to be Aware of Elder Fraud

The Auglaize County Sheriff’s Office is urging residents to be aware of elder fraud.

Scammers are targeting seniors with phone calls, emails, computer pop-ups, text messages and letters designed to steal money and personal information.

You should not share personal information over the phone unless you are certain of the recipient, and never send money or gift cards to strangers.

You should also verify any claims of emergencies or prize winnings with trusted sources before responding and report suspicious activity to the Federal Trade Commission.

Residents are encouraged to share this message with friends and family, especially senior residents.
